int main( int argc, char** argv )
{
    char* filename = argc >= 2 ? argv[1] : (char*)"fruits.jpg";

    if( (img0 = cvLoadImage(filename,-1)) == 0 )
        return 0;

    printf( "Hot keys: \n"
            "\tESC - quit the program\n"
            "\tr - restore the original image\n"
            "\ti or SPACE - run inpainting algorithm\n"
            "\t\t(before running it, paint something on the image)\n" );
    
    cvNamedWindow( "image", 1 );

    img = cvCloneImage( img0 );
    inpainted = cvCloneImage( img0 );
    inpaint_mask = cvCreateImage( cvGetSize(img), 8, 1 );

    cvZero( inpaint_mask );
    cvZero( inpainted );
    cvShowImage( "image", img );
    cvShowImage( "inpainted image", inpainted );
    cvSetMouseCallback( "image", on_mouse, 0 );

    for(;;)
    {
        int c = cvWaitKey(0);

        if( (char)c == 27 )
            break;

        if( (char)c == 'r' )
        {
            cvZero( inpaint_mask );
            cvCopy( img0, img );
            cvShowImage( "image", img );
        }

        if( (char)c == 'i' || (char)c == ' ' )
        {
            cvNamedWindow( "inpainted image", 1 );
            cvInpaint( img, inpaint_mask, inpainted, 3, CV_INPAINT_TELEA );
            cvShowImage( "inpainted image", inpainted );
        }
    }

    return 1;
}

static void do_inpainting(IplImage* frame, int radius, const CvRect& roi)
{
    IplImage* g = cvCreateImage(cvSize(frame->width,frame->height), IPL_DEPTH_8U, 1);
    IplImage* m = cvCreateImage(cvSize(frame->width,frame->height), IPL_DEPTH_8U, 1);
    cvZero(m);

    cvCvtColor(frame, g, CV_RGB2GRAY);

    cvSetImageROI(g, roi);
    cvSetImageROI(m, roi);

    double min, max;

    cvMinMaxLoc(g, &min, &max);

    cvThreshold(g, m, 0.4*(max + min), 255, CV_THRESH_BINARY);

    cvResetImageROI(m);

    cvInpaint(frame, m, frame, radius, CV_INPAINT_TELEA);

    cvReleaseImage(&g);
    cvReleaseImage(&m);
}
